Four Years After Dodd-Frank, Ex-Senator Wary Of Law Tweaks

By Ed Beeson (July 15, 2014, 7:41 PM EDT) -- Nearly four years after the passage of the Dodd-Frank Act, one of the financial reform law's namesakes on Tuesday expressed few regrets with the finished product but warned that attempts to fix the law's shortcomings nowawdays would signal an opening to opponents who want to undo it entirely....
